This is probaly the most compelling game I have played so far in my 10 years of gaming.  So far I have about 40 hours into this game and I am still not close to having everything unlocked, or every character maxed out.   
This game starts out with the main character waking up from a 2 year nap.  I will not go any further into the story so it will not be ruined for you.  The story is very funny at most if not all times.  Its a very light story nothing to be taken seriously like FFX. 
The graphics are on par with about FFT, but after playing it you wont really care.  It is more of cartoonish graphics then real ones.   
Sound is also very good.  The voice work is quite well done, and entertaining.  Battle sounds are also well done. 
The replay value is insane.  9 999 levels to get your characters up to, you can level up your weapons in the item world and find new items all the time.  There are multiple endings, and after you beat the game you can restart with your created characters.  You can only get the story characters when you would get them in the story.  You can reset you levels back to one and get stat bonuses using the dark assembly.  The dark assembly is a place when you can pass bills to unlock new levels or get better items at the shop or stronger enemies.   
Overall you should get this game. Don't rent it just buy it if you can find it in stores it is getting harder and harder to find.
